Output 2d35bd19ace71cf5f87bd9a9798f5d24a04d5e705353b5e6fc1c594f8256a26a:8

value
28361338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56badc1f4ba63575bbc97000954872d8c7f282e0 OP_EQUAL
address
39bbtHrJhaCBfp51GoRJryVj1aByibWtVA
transaction
2d35bd19ace71cf5f87bd9a9798f5d24a04d5e705353b5e6fc1c594f8256a26a
spent
true